Output 2eefe595030486fb16665f0092fa758ea63b9172774aac7d00718ed348f8b070:2
- value
- 26588639
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b68735e1f375bfde67f039e07a5c37301face6fa OP_EQUAL
- address
- MQYHBw1r61YuKy8r2Pt3TkHWP2duFtqyRr
- transaction
- 2eefe595030486fb16665f0092fa758ea63b9172774aac7d00718ed348f8b070
- spent
- true